BRIDGING ACADEMIA AND INDUSTRY: A SYSTEMATIC LITERATURE REVIEW OF SOFTWARE ENGINEERING EDUCATION APPROACHES AND THEIR EFFECTIVENESS

Authors

Keywords:

Academia-Industry Gap, Systematic Literature Review, Software Engineering Education, Project-Based Learning, Agile Education, Industry Collaboration, Competency-Based Assessment

Abstract

The gap between academia and industry remains a major challenge in software engineering education. Rapid technological change requires graduates to possess not only strong theoretical knowledge but also practical competencies, collaboration skills, and familiarity with real software development practices. This study presents a Systematic Literature Review (SLR) examining educational approaches used to bridge the academia-industry gap in software engineering education. A total of 54 scientific articles published between 2015 and 2024 were reviewed through a structured selection process based on PRISMA principles. The review focuses on curriculum design, project-based learning, agile-based education, industry collaboration, capstone projects, internships, and competency-based assessment. The findings show that project-based learning, agile learning, industry partnerships, and internship programs are the most frequently used approaches to improve students' readiness for professional roles. However, challenges remain in aligning university learning outcomes with rapidly changing industry expectations, particularly regarding practical experience, soft skills, and exposure to real tools and workflows. This article provides recommendations for strengthening software engineering education through adaptive curricula, stronger industry involvement, and continuous competency-based evaluation.

References

Barbosa, M. W. (2022). Using blended project-based learning to teach project management to software engineering students. International Journal of Mobile and Blended Learning, 14(1), 1-18.

Garousi, V., Giray, G., Tuzun, E., Catal, C., & Felderer, M. (2020). Closing the gap between software engineering education and industrial needs. IEEE Software, 37(2), 68-77.

Meissner, B., & Stenger, H.-J. (2025). Exploring the impact of integrating problem-based learning and agile in the classroom on enhancing professional competence. Journal of Software Engineering Education and Practice, 15(1), 45-62.

Ouhbi, S., Idri, A., Fernandez-Aleman, J. L., & Toval, A. (2015). Requirements engineering education: A systematic mapping study. Requirements Engineering, 20, 119-138.

Radermacher, A., & Walia, G. (2013). Gaps between industry expectations and the abilities of graduates. Proceedings of the 44th ACM Technical Symposium on Computer Science Education, 525-530.

Meiszner, A., & Stamelos, I. (2022). Educational methods for software engineering practice and employability. Software Engineering Education Review, 12(2), 33-49.

Krusche, S., & Seitz, A. (2018). ArTEMiS: An automatic assessment management system for interactive learning. Proceedings of the 49th ACM Technical Symposium on Computer Science Education, 284-289.

Paasivaara, M., Heikkila, V. T., & Lassenius, C. (2018). Teaching students global software engineering skills using distributed Scrum. Proceedings of the International Conference on Software Engineering Education and Training, 1-10.

Stroulia, E., Bauer, K., Craig, M., Reid, K., & Wilson, G. (2011). Teaching distributed software engineering with UCOSP. Proceedings of the International Conference on Software Engineering Education and Training, 20-29.

Clear, T., & MacDonell, S. G. (2011). Understanding technology use in global virtual teams: Research methodologies and methods. Information and Software Technology, 53(9), 994-1011.

Kitchenham, B., & Charters, S. (2007). Guidelines for performing systematic literature reviews in software engineering. EBSE Technical Report.

Petersen, K., Vakkalanka, S., & Kuzniarz, L. (2015). Guidelines for conducting systematic mapping studies in software engineering. Information and Software Technology, 64, 1-18.

Hazzan, O., & Dubinsky, Y. (2014). Agile anywhere: Essays on agile projects and beyond. Springer.

Mills, J. E., & Treagust, D. F. (2003). Engineering education: Is problem-based or project-based learning the answer? Australasian Journal of Engineering Education, 3(2), 2-16.

Aliyah, Lukita, C., Pangilinan, G. A., Chakim, M. H. R., & Saputra, D. B. (2023). Examining the Impact of Artificial Intelligence and Internet of Things on Smart Tourism Destinations: A Comprehensive Study. Aptisi Transactions on Technopreneurship (ATT), 5(2sp), 135–145. https://doi.org/10.34306/att.v5i2sp.332

Henderi, H., Asro, A., Sulaiman, A., Kurniawan, T., Dewi, D., & AlQudah, M. (2024). Utilizing Sentiment Analysis for Reflect and Improve Education in Indonesia. Journal of Applied Data Sciences, 6(1), 189-200. doi:https://doi.org/10.47738/jads.v6i1.527

Asro Asro, Solihin Solihin, & Irlon Irlon. (2026). Executive Decision Support System Implementation Strategies Based on Big Data Analytics to Improve Operational Efficiency and Corporate Governance in Global Digital Enterprises. Integrated System and Management Technology , 1(1), 43–51. https://doi.org/10.66472/ismat.v1i1.13

Downloads

Published

2026-05-31

How to Cite

BRIDGING ACADEMIA AND INDUSTRY: A SYSTEMATIC LITERATURE REVIEW OF SOFTWARE ENGINEERING EDUCATION APPROACHES AND THEIR EFFECTIVENESS. (2026). Prosiding Amal Insani Foundation, 3, 166-177. https://prosiding.amalinsani.org/index.php/semnas/article/view/21